Oxfam Canada is proud to join the Equality Fund Collective, and welcomes the Government of Canada’s funding announcement

June 2, 2019

(Vancouver) – The Government of Canada announced today that it will provide $300 million in funding to the Equality Fund, a unique partnership to catalyze new investments in support of gender equality and women’s rights. Mozambique cyclone appeal allots less than 1% to needs of women and girls

May 30, 2019

Oxfam, Save the Children and Care are calling on donors to meet or exceed the proposed $5 million target to fund programs that support vulnerable women and girls ahead of a donor conference in Beira, Mozambique on May 31. It’s time for all federal parties to support an affordable public child care system in Canada, says national coalition

May 14, 2019

(Ottawa) – Child benefit payments worth $23.7 billion are given to almost 3.7 million families across the country annually, and yet, Canada has some of the highest child care costs amongst its international peers, leaving families struggling to make ends meet.
